2. IF Counter Operation

Before starting the IF count, the IF counter must be reset in advance by setting CTE in the serial data to 0.
The IF count is started by changing the CTE bit in the serial data from 0 to 1. The serial data is latched by the
LC72135M when the CE pin is dropped from high to low. The IF signal must be supplied to the HCTR and LCTR
pins in the period between the point the CE pin goes low and the end of the wait time at the latest. Next, the value of
the IF counter at the end of the measurement period must be read out during the period that CTE is 1. This is because
the IF counter is reset when CTE is set to 0.

Note that the LC72135M input sensitivity can be controlled with the IFS bit in the serial data.
Reduced sensitivity mode (IFS = 0) must be selected when this IC is used in conjunction with an IF-IC that
does not provide an SD output and auto-search is implemented using only IF counting.
